Future of oil-and-gas industry in Texas is uncertain, economist says. Since the recent drop in oil prices from $100 per barrel to around $50 per barrel, predictions about where prices are going have been all over the board. Estimates have been as low as $20 per barrel and as high as $200 per barrel. Texas leads the nation in both oil and natural gas production.
